Power needs

If there is a professional on the subject, what is the major problem in electrical power from the body?

  • Not an expert, but the human body only produces small voltages (couple of millivolts) and currents, not enough to power a device (otherwise we'd fashion instruments to charge our cell phones from our skin). Also, there's the matter of harnessing the energy since it's usually in the form of chemical energy. The only electrical "energy" available in the body is through action potentials, usually used for "signalling" (neurons, muscles), not "powering" them (which is done by ATP and other chemical reactions). Need to split this up.

Artificial hearts are just what the name implies--replacements for the biological heart. They are not ventricular assist devices, baloon pumps, or bypass machines. Those subjects need to be dealt with on their own page.

Also, there is no mention in this article of the CardioWest artificial heart or the company that manufactures it. This device is approved in the US and Europe, just received approval for coverage by the US Medicare system, and has over 20 of its hearts in patients worldwide at any one time. The manufacturer, Syncardia Systems, Inc., continues development of the device and of improved driver consoles. The latest incarnation of the latter is a miniature 4-pound replacement for the 450-pound "Big-Blue" console currently in use.

There is no mention of the artificial heart developed in Queensland Australia (Brisbane's Prince Charles Hospital) to be marketed under the name Bivacor. This device which fits inside a human body and can mimic the pumping fluctuations of a healthy heart. The key elements of the Bivacor's design: The titanium device – which is about the size of a fist has a revolutionary pump that duplicates the function of both sides of the heart. It is driven by tiny electromagnets, the pump's twin rotors can alter speed and position to suit blood-flow depending on a patient's activities. The Bivacor allows patients free movement and will reduce the risk of infection, by being secured inside the body and without external tubes. Once in production, the Bivacor, which has been patented, is expected to cost about $60,000 a unit. Most of the funding for the Bivacor project – about $250,000 so far – came from the Prince Charles Hospital Foundation raising funds through selling ice creams at the [[Ekka]http://en.wikipedia.org/wiki/Ekka]. The Bivacor is expected to be in clinical trials in the next three years if the team can secure funding of $3 million. Accusatory tone in article

In the First clinical implantation of a total artificial heart section, there's a rather accusatory tone towards the two doctors who installed an artificial heart in a man who very shortly after died with a heart transplant, saying that it was a huge mistake removing the fake heart from him to transplant a real one, because if they had left the fake one in him he might've lived longer. Well the original intent of the fake heart in the first place was to act as a placeholder for a real heart, it was never the goal to have him permanently live with the fake heart. That he died from complications resulting from the transplant was indeed sad but unsurprising, even today there's a high mortality rate that occurs with organ transplantation, imagine how much higher that risk was back in 1969, when medical science and technology were nowhere near as advanced as today's. The doctors shouldn't be made to look like it was their fault the patient died, they were using radical technology to attempt to save a life back then, that should be noted even in spite of the failure that did not appear to be their fault. 173.2.165.251 (talk) 12:58, 4 June 2011 (UTC)[reply]
